  Fault finding by self-check mode. 

This  series  wine  cellar  has  a  computerized  controller  with  built  in  self-check  function.  Start  the  self-check 
mode as follows: 

 

1>. Press and hold 

Set lower

 and 

Set upper

 button with power on.    2 beeps will sound, and then 

the controller will start the self-check function, 

 

2>. If everything is operating correctly, 
a.

 

No response when pressing buttons.

 

b.

 

LED  only  display  20

  if  ambient  temperature  is  over  20

,  and  display  actual  temperature  if  ambient 

temperature is lower than 20

c.

 

The compressor works and the 

RUN

 indicator light are on all the time.

 

d.

 

If  the  cooler  has  condenser  and  evaporator  fans  they  should  work  at  full  speed;  Heater  and  air       

cycling fans should work for 30 seconds alternately.

 

e.

 

The switch controls the light functions normally.

 

 

3>.If the situation fit for 

a~e statement, the spear parts are normal, i

f the various components of the unit do 

not  respond  as  above,  check  the  faulty  part  and  relevant  connection.  If  replace  the  part does  not  cure 
the fault, replace the control board. see.

 (

4)

 

4>. To return the control panel to its normal working mode unplug the unit and plug it in again 
5>. Only the new version control panel has a self-check mode.

 

 

  Sensor default

 

1>. The LED temperature display  should the actual ambient temperature shortly  after the unit is 
plugged in, if not,take the electrical box apart see

 

(Page 6)

, check if

 

the sensor plug is connected 

properly, if the connections are good and the fault persists replace the sensor.

   

2>. If the LED displays 

E1

 indicates a  freezing compartment sensor open circuit fault and the 

sensor should be replaced see

 

(Page 18)

 

3>. If the LED displays 

E2

 indicates a freezing compartment sensor short circuit fault and the 

sensor should be replaced see

 (Page 18).

 

           

      4>.  If  the  LED  displays 

E3

  indicates  an  evaporator  sensor  open  circuit  fault  and  the  sensor 

should be replaced see

 

(Page 18).

 

5>.  If  the  LED  displays 

E4

  indicates  an  evaporator  sensor  short  circuit  fault  and  the  sensor 

should be replaced see

 

(Page 18).

 

6>. If the LED displays 

E7

 indicates a refrigeration compartment sensor open circuit fault
